Reason 1: Your System Was Never Sized for Your Actual Usage
This is the single biggest reason solar panels fail to deliver savings across India. If the system on your roof is too small for your real electricity consumption it covers only a fraction of your load and the rest continues to arrive from the grid at full tariff rates.
A proper solar installation must begin with a careful review of your electricity bills across at least 12 months. Your installer needs to understand your average monthly consumption your peak load and how usage is spread across different times of day. If this step was rushed or ignored you likely ended up with an undersized system that was never going to make a meaningful impact.
Around 40 percent of underperforming systems we audit across Gujarat are simply too small for the home or business they were sold to. Resizing or expanding these systems often restores the full savings the customer was originally promised.

Reason 2: Shading Is Silently Stealing Your Output
Even a small shadow falling on just one or two panels can pull down the output of your entire solar array far more than most people realise. A water tank a boundary wall an overhead cable or a neighbouring building casting shade for even two to three hours a day creates a meaningful drop in generation across the whole month.
The tricky part is that shading issues are often invisible. They shift with the time of day and the season. Your panels might get full sun in the morning but sit in shadow through the afternoon without you ever noticing. Common culprits include water tanks positioned too close to panels boundary walls casting afternoon shadow overhead power lines and neighbouring buildings that have grown taller since your installation.

Reason 3: Your Inverter Is the Weak Link Nobody Told You About
The inverter converts DC power from your panels into usable AC power for your home or business. If it is undersized poorly configured or silently malfunctioning your entire system underperforms no matter how good your panels are. This is especially common in installations where cheap inverters were used to make the quote look more attractive upfront.
Warning signs to watch for include the system shutting down during peak afternoon hours unexplained dips in generation on clear sunny days and error codes on the inverter display that were never investigated after installation. Resolving inverter-related issues alone can recover up to 20 percent of lost output without replacing a single panel.

Reason 4: Net Metering Was Never Activated on Your Account
When your solar system generates more electricity than you consume during the day that surplus should flow back to the grid and get credited on your monthly bill. But if your net metering application was not filed correctly or is stuck in paperwork with your local DISCOM you are simply giving away excess power with no credit and no savings.
This is a very common and very costly gap in Gujarat. It requires direct and persistent follow-up with your electricity board and your solar company should be handling this for you not the other way around.

Reason 5: Dust Buildup and Rising Consumption Are Widening the Gap
Gujarat's dry season brings heavy dust and panels that have not been cleaned in a few months can silently lose 15 to 20 percent of their output with no error message and no warning sign. On top of that if your electricity usage has gone up since installation whether from a new air conditioner more appliances or an extra floor added to your property your system may simply no longer be large enough to cover your current needs.
Both problems are fixable but you have to catch them first and that requires regular monitoring and a solar company that stays engaged well after installation day.
